nir/algebraic: Add some optimizations for D3D-style Booleans

D3D Booleans use a 32-bit 0/-1 representation.  Because this previously
matched NIR exactly, we didn't have to really optimize for it.  Now that
we have 1-bit Booleans, we need some specific optimizations to chew
through the D3D12-style Booleans.

Shader-db results on Kaby Lake:

    total instructions in shared programs: 15136811 -> 14967944 (-1.12%)
    instructions in affected programs: 2457021 -> 2288154 (-6.87%)
    helped: 8318
    HURT: 10

    total cycles in shared programs: 373544524 -> 359701825 (-3.71%)
    cycles in affected programs: 151029683 -> 137186984 (-9.17%)
    helped: 7749
    HURT: 682

    total loops in shared programs: 4431 -> 4399 (-0.72%)
    loops in affected programs: 32 -> 0
    helped: 21
    HURT: 0

    total spills in shared programs: 10290 -> 10051 (-2.32%)
    spills in affected programs: 2532 -> 2293 (-9.44%)
    helped: 18
    HURT: 18

    total fills in shared programs: 22203 -> 21732 (-2.12%)
    fills in affected programs: 3319 -> 2848 (-14.19%)
    helped: 18
    HURT: 18

Note that a large chunk of the improvement fixing regressions caused by
switching to 1-bit Booleans.  Previously, our ability to optimize D3D
booleans was improved by using the D3D representation directly in NIR.
Now that NIR does 1-bit bools, we need a few more optimizations.

@ -534,6 +534,19 @@ optimizations = [
(('bcsel', a, b, b), b),
(('fcsel', a, b, b), b),
# D3D Boolean emulation
(('bcsel', a, -1, 0), ('ineg', ('b2i', 'a@1'))),
(('bcsel', a, 0, -1), ('ineg', ('b2i', ('inot', a)))),
(('iand', ('ineg', ('b2i', 'a@1')), ('ineg', ('b2i', 'b@1'))),
('ineg', ('b2i', ('iand', a, b)))),
(('ior', ('ineg', ('b2i','a@1')), ('ineg', ('b2i', 'b@1'))),
('ineg', ('b2i', ('ior', a, b)))),
(('ieq', ('ineg', ('b2i', 'a@1')), 0), ('inot', a)),
(('ieq', ('ineg', ('b2i', 'a@1')), -1), a),
(('ine', ('ineg', ('b2i', 'a@1')), 0), a),
(('ine', ('ineg', ('b2i', 'a@1')), -1), ('inot', a)),
(('iand', ('ineg', ('b2i', a)), '1.0@32'), ('b2f', a)),
